Diocese of Bossangoa, Central African Republic 🇨🇫

Celebrations

History

  • 1959.02.09: Established as Apostolic Prefecture of Bossangoa / Bossangoën(sis) (Latin) (from Diocese of Berbérati)
  • 1964.01.16: Promoted as Diocese of Bossangoa / Bossangoën(sis) (Latin) (became suffragan of Bangui)

Statistics (2017.12.31)

Area: 62,680 km²

Population: 458,000 Catholics (61.0% of 751,000 total)

Pastoral Centres: 14 parishes

Personnel: 27 priests (diocesan), 1 deacon, 9 religious (2 brothers, 7 sisters), 12 seminarians
